Vulnerabilidad en API Platform Core (CVE-2025-31485)
Gravedad CVSS v3.1:
ALTA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
03/04/2025
Última modificación:
08/04/2025
Descripción
API Platform Core es un sistema para crear API REST y GraphQL basadas en hipermedia. Antes de la versión 4.0.22, una concesión GraphQL en una propiedad podía almacenarse en caché con diferentes objetos. El método ApiPlatform\GraphQl\Serializer\ItemNormalizer::isCacheKeySafe() impide el almacenamiento en caché, pero el método parent::normalize, que se invoca posteriormente, sigue creando la clave de caché y causando el problema. Esta vulnerabilidad se corrigió en la versión 4.0.22.
Impacto
Puntuación base 3.x
7.50
Gravedad 3.x
ALTA
Referencias a soluciones, herramientas e información
- https://github.com/api-platform/core/commit/7af65aad13037d7649348ee3dcd88e084ef771f8
- https://github.com/api-platform/core/commit/cba3acfbd517763cf320167250c5bed6d569696a
- https://github.com/api-platform/core/releases/tag/v3.4.17
- https://github.com/api-platform/core/security/advisories/GHSA-428q-q3vv-3fq3